And this letter is my forgiveness." Berkley received it when he was not particularly sober; and lighting the end of it at a candle let it burn until the last ashes scorched his fingers.
"Burgess," he said, "did you ever notice how hard it is for the frailer things to die?
Those wild doves we used to shoot in Georgia--by God! it took quail shot to kill them clean." "Yes, sir ?" "Exactly.

Then, that being the case, you may give me a particularly vigorous shampoo.

Because, Burgess, I woo my volatile goddess to-night--the Goddess Chance, Burgess, whose wanton and naughty eyes never miss the fall of a card.

And I desire that all my senses work like lightning, Burgess, because it is a fast company and a faster game, and that's why I want an unusually muscular shampoo!" "Yes, sir.
